Mission: What is Myriad Mission Statement?
Companys’s mission is 'to advance health and well-being for all by empowering patients and healthcare providers with genetic insights that enable precise health decisions.'
Myriad Company mission statement centers on delivering actionable genetic insights to patients and clinicians, expanding access to precision care across oncology and mental health while prioritizing patient outcomes and clinical utility.
Targets individual patients and healthcare providers to support collaborative care decisions.
Uses genetic testing to reduce trial-and-error treatments, notably in psychotropic prescribing.
Universal germline testing for all cancer patients broadens reach and equity in care.
Clinical utility emphasized through outcomes and adoption metrics in 2025.
By 2025 the GeneSight test has guided medication choice for over 2.5 million patients, demonstrating scale.
Focuses on utility of results for end-users rather than sequencing alone.

Values: What is Myriad Core Values Statement?
Core values guide behavior and decisions at Myriad Company, shaping culture and market actions. These principles drive patient-centered care, scientific excellence, innovation, and ethical accountability across operations.
Clinical utility and patient advocacy take precedence over commercial gain, supported by programs that enabled access to testing for over 80,000 patients in the last fiscal year.
Decisions are evidence-based, backed by more than 1,000 peer-reviewed studies and validation of AI-driven risk models against clinical outcomes before deployment.
R&D investment of roughly 10–12% of revenue fuels advances such as NGS adoption and the FirstGene prenatal screen to simplify testing workflows.
Strict data privacy protocols and transparent clinical reporting establish trust with health systems and biopharma partners for trials and population health initiatives.

How Mission & Vision Influence Myriad Business?
Mission and vision shape strategic decisions by setting long-term priorities and aligning capital allocation with stated purpose; they guide product focus, partnerships, and operational metrics. Clear mission and vision reduce strategic drift and enable measurable portfolio shifts toward higher-growth areas.
The mission directs resource allocation to precision health while the vision frames long-term patient engagement and platform development.
- The mission emphasizes empowering providers and patients with actionable genetic insights
- The vision positions the company as a lifelong advisor through digital health and patient portals
- Core values prioritize scientific rigor, patient-centricity, integrity, and collaboration
- Strategic metrics tie mission to outcomes: revenue mix, turnaround time, and growth in target segments
In 2025 the company shifted capital away from non-core assets to focus on Precise Oncology and Mental Health.
15 percent year-over-year growth in the oncology portfolio as of Q2 2025 illustrates mission-driven results.
Average turnaround time for MyRisk reduced to under 7 days, aligning operational KPIs with the mission to empower providers.
CEO and leadership cite the 'lifelong advisor' vision when prioritizing digital health tools and patient engagement platforms.
Partnerships with integrated delivery networks were chosen to normalize genetic insights as part of standard care, consistent with company purpose.
